In the Face of Disaster

Lord God, we don't know how to pray.
This immense disaster feels overwhelming.
We can only imagine how the victims feel,
And we are so many miles away that we feel helpless.
Surround those directly involved with your loving presence.
Comfort the families of the dead and injured,
Sustain those waiting for word of those they love.
Protect, strengthen, and uphold the rescuers and emergency personnel.
Help all of us to remember that your love
Is bigger and stronger than despair and destruction.
Guide and strengthen us to reach out to those affected in ways that will bring healing.
Give them and us a sense of your peace and hope.
In the name of Jesus, our friend and healer, Amen.


From page 60, Prayers for Life's Ordinary and Extraordinary Moments, compiled and edited by Mary Lou Redding. Copyright © 2012 by Upper Room Books. All rights reserved. Used by permission.
